What is the Apache Knuckle Duster Gun-Knife?



The Apache knuckle duster gun-knife is a little, multi-practical weapon that originated in nineteenth-century France. Its structure was credited for the underworld gangs in Paris, generally named "Les Apaches," who ended up recognized for their brutal strategies and Road violence. The weapon, a favorite between gang associates, was intended to be Utilized in shut-quarters beat, combining three lethal features into just one gadget:

1. Brass Knuckles – Used for striking an opponent in hand-to-hand combat.
2. Folding Knife – For stabbing or slashing.
three. Pepperbox Revolver – A little-caliber, multi-shot gun for ranged defense.

This lethal blend designed the Apache gun-knife incredibly versatile and helpful in Avenue brawls, exactly where brief, shut-up combating was typical. It absolutely was especially favored by criminals who needed a hid weapon which could serve multiple purposes.

So how exactly does the Apache Gun-Knife Do the job?



To start with glance, the Apache gun-knife looks like a wierd, compact device with many shifting components. It features brass knuckles for putting, a folding blade for reducing or stabbing, and a little pepperbox revolver that would fireplace A few .27 caliber rounds.

- The brass knuckles have been fixed into the human body in the weapon, permitting the wielder to punch with included drive.
- The knife was generally a fold-out blade that might be deployed when needed for stabbing or slashing.
- The revolver was an early pepperbox model, which could hold 6 pictures. However, it lacked a barrel, indicating its precision was quite bad outside of several feet.

The Increase and Drop of the Apache Knuckle Duster



The Apache gun-knife rose to prominence in the course of the late 1800s, specifically in Paris, exactly where Road gangs just like the Apaches ruled the underworld. It was a great weapon for criminals: smaller, easily hidden, and perfect for close-quarters confrontation. What's more, it carried a psychological edge. The sight of this kind of multi-functional weapon, capable of punching, stabbing, and taking pictures, could effortlessly intimidate.

However, Inspite of its usefulness, the Apache knuckle duster gun-knife was not with no its flaws. The revolver, For example, lacked a barrel, rendering it mostly ineffective at anything at all in addition to point-blank assortment. On top of that, the smaller caliber of your ammunition confined its stopping electricity. Eventually, as firearms technological innovation State-of-the-art and simpler weapons became accessible, the Apache gun-knife fell out of favor.

By apache knuckle duster gun for sale the early twentieth century, Along with the rise of additional reputable and correct firearms, the Apache gun-knife turned much more of the historical curiosity than a practical weapon. Right now, it is mostly present in museums, private collections, or as reproductions for fanatics enthusiastic about special historical arms.
